Like the current VEKN system, except as follows:
1) A whole victory point is granted for last man standing,
withdrawal, and survival to time out (ie... whenever not ousted).
2) For tournament ranking, both game wins and victory points are
dispensed with. In its place, a victory score is used, based on
victory points as follows:
Victory Victory
Points Score
0 0
1 1
2 10
3 100
4 107
5 115
3) Tournament points are used for 2d tier tie breakers; there is no
third tier.
------------------
As long as there are less than 10 preliminary rounds, The hundred
points for 3 vp is the functionally similar to a game win trumping any
number of victory points under the current system -- except that 3 vp
is effectively treated as the new game win requirement.

Like all my proposals, this seeks to restore the original vp system,
and to award time-out scores consistent with the original paradigm.
My first and second versions sought to preserve -- fairly closely --
the current conditions for a "game win". However, this meant the
definition for a game win had to be changed, since the elimination of
half vps resulted in players with a single oust in time out games
gaining 2 vps, and therefore scoring game wins provided no-one else
had done the same (as when a 5-player table times out with 4 players
remaining). To prevent this, but otherwise preserve game wins
conditions, I presented the following definition: "3 vps are required
in time-out games; whereas in completed games one needs more vp than
any other player."
XZealot and others complained that this definition was "too clunky".
On later consideration, I found no reason not to change the
definition, for tournament scoring purposes, to a much more simple &
elegant "3vp = game win". The 2-vp game win, besides being rather
rare, did not seem to me to be the sort of game win that was
particularly deserving of high honors. Moreover, it seemed to me that
I was adequately loyal to the spirit of the original rules provided
the 2 vp "game winner" received a higher score than anyone else at his
particular table (which he always does). He did not need to be ranked
as high as a 3 vp game winner, nor need he be ranked any lower than
the two players who (to use Salem's phrase) "tie for the win" at
another table.
Having thought of making 3 vp consistently equal a "game win", I found
no reason not to merge game wins into the "victory score" idea that I
had introduced in my second proposal.
A game win trumps any lesser score (or any variation among higher
scores). Since there are rarely (if ever) more than 3 preliminary
rounds, this can be effectively simulated by having the score for a 3-
vps win be more than 3 times higher than any lesser score (or any
variation among higher scores). In this case, I used a factor of 10
(just because it seemed convenient).
Similarly, to provide maximum "risk incentive" to a player who has not
bothered to score a vp yet, I create a case where a single two vp
score trumps any number (such as 3) of 1 vp scores. Once again, I use
a factor of 10.
No attempt is made to provide risk incentives to players who have
already scored two ousts. A player with 2 ousts has far more to lose
by being ousted than he has to gain by ousting. This is no different
from the current VEKN system (where no vp bribe can outweigh the game
win the player has to lose), and no different from my earlier
proposals.
Nor is any attempt made to provide a risk incentive to the player with
3 ousts scored and one player left to devour. I really don't think
this guy needs any fire under his butt. As it happens, a slight risk
incentive is provided (7 to lose versus 8 to gain), which is rather
less than the current VEKN system (.5 to lose versus 1.5 to gain).
I could made 4 and 5 worth 110 and 120 respectively, but decided to
avoid tie scores. Hence, 4,0,0 is worth less than 3,2,0 but more than
3,1,1. 5,0,0 is worth more than 3,2,0, but less than 3,2,2.

One interesting change in the system vs. the current is the devaluation of
consistency vs. feast-or-famine that the TP system provides.
If player A has a 3-2, 2-3, 0-5 finish over three tables and player B has a 3-2,
1-4, 1-4 finish, the current system ranks B over A (on tournament points), while
the proposed system ranks player A higher (since VP #2 in the second game is
worth more than VP #1 in the third).
And, to be sure everyone follows along with the "current system" parallel
alluded to above, here's the current system (or rather, a
functionally-equivalent recasting of the current system):
VPs VS
--- ---
0 0
1 10
2< 20
2> 120
3 130
4 140
5 150
Where 2< indicates 2VPs but no GW (i.e., someone else has 2 or more VPs in that
game). And 2> means 2VPs with a GW.
You can recast the per-VP score to any suitably small number, of course. The 10
used was just an example. 1 would also get the same result:
VPs VS
--- ---
0 0
1 1
2< 2
2> 102
3 103
4 104
5 105

I can't speak for the author, but I am guessing it is:
-Make 1VP worth something, but far less than a "GW".
-Make 2VP worth something, but far less than a "GW".
-Make a 3VP "GW" the main goal of the game.
-Give you a bonus for 4 and 5 VPs, but a small one that makes them more
or less equivalent to single VPs, but cuts down on the tie situations
that would show up if all the VPs were equal.
Given a system of:
1VP=1
2VP=10
3VP=100
4VP=107
5VP=115
you have the most incentive to get a 3VP "GW", and any extra VPs over
that are just minimal tie breaker points. But if the system were:
1VP=10
2VP=20
3VP=100
4VP=110
5VP=120
Ties would show up all the time. And with the proposed system, getting a
5VP sweep is worth more than 2VP in game A and 3VP in game B. Which may
or may not be something that is something that is necessary. But ok.

Good point. That result is incongruous. If anything, it would be
more consistent with the general theme of the proposal to have the
extreme scores beat the more-average scores. If anything, 4,1 should
beat 3,2, just as 3,0,0 beats 2,2,2 and 2,0,0 beats 1,1,1. This can
only be achieved by an escalation in intervals value (ignoring the
whopping 90-point "game win" interval at the 3 vp level).
Perhaps the following would work better:
Victory Victory
Point Score
0 0
1 3
2 10
3 100
4 108
5 117
However, I am unsure about whether 3,5 should beat 4,4, or whether
that gives too much advantage to 5-player tables. Perhaps the
escalation should not continue after 4, and the value should be 116,
or even pull back to 115.
One could create a situation where the pattern was reversed for
extremes centered on 3,3 (ie. 3,3 beats 4,2 which in turn beats 5,1)
but holds true in all other cases:
Victory Victory
Point Score
0 0
1 3
2 10
3 100
4 109
5 115
Or one could make it balanced but skewed at the extremes:
Victory Victory
Point Score
0 0
1 3
2 10
3 100
4 107
5 110
This tends to promote ties, which I'm not sure is good, now that half
vps are eliminated.
Or elimiante "extra" risk incentives and make it completely balanced:
Victory Victory
Point Score
0 0
1 1
2 2
3 100
4 101
5 102
This also tends to promote tie scores.

Part of my motivation is to avoid ties. I am a bit worried that by
eliminating half victory points, I make tie scores too common.
However, I don't want to do this arbitrarily. There should be some
logic it.
> Or why the first VP is worth almost
> nothing.
Well, that's just maximum risk incentive -- giving players (almost)
nothing to lose compared to time out, and everything to gain. Nothing
slows a game down like 5 players playing cautiously and
conservatively, so if any risk incentive is needed besides the game
win itself, the place to focus that incentive is on those 5 starting
players who have not scored ousts yet. Once players start getting
knocked out, things start to speed up naturally.
Any value for 1 vp that was less than 1/3 of the value for 2 vp would
have achieved the desired effect (in a tournament with no more than 3
preliminary rounds). I liked the "propaganda value" of giving a score
of 1 instead of 3. I added this change shortly before posting without
adequately thinking through other consequences.
I'm still not convinced that any risk incentive is needed besides the
game win.
